Optimizing HVAC Systems for Energy Efficiency in Commercial Buildings

Project Objectives:

Evaluate current HVAC systems in commercial buildings to identify areas for improvement in energy efficiency.

Research and implement innovative technologies and strategies to optimize HVAC systems for better energy performance.

Conduct cost-benefit analyses to determine the feasibility and economic viability of proposed energy-efficient HVAC solutions.

Project Tasks:

Conduct a comprehensive literature review on energy-efficient HVAC technologies and best practices in commercial buildings.

Collaborate with senior engineers to assess the performance of existing HVAC systems in various commercial buildings.

Develop proposals for implementing energy-saving measures, such as upgrading equipment, improving insulation, and enhancing system controls.

Work with building owners and facility managers to gather relevant data and feedback on proposed HVAC optimization measures.

Analyze energy consumption data to quantify potential energy savings and environmental impact of the proposed solutions.

Present findings and recommendations to the engineering team and assist in overseeing the implementation of energy-efficient HVAC upgrades.
